2008 Nissan Altima

2008 Nissan Altima Continues Tradition of Exceptional Performance, Style, Quality and Innovation

2008 Nissan Altima
–Altima Continues to Set the Bar as Alternative to 'Run of the Mill' Sedans –

The dramatic, fourth-generation Nissan Altima, introduced for the 2007 model year, could not have had a better rookie season – setting sales records and winning the AutoPacific 2007 Vehicle Satisfaction Award for Premium Mid-Size Cars and the J.D. Power and Associates 2007 Automotive Performance, Execution and Layout (APEAL) StudySM as the highest ranked mid-size car.

For its sophomore year, the 2008 Altima adds a number of enhancements, including standard Anti-lock Braking System (ABS) with Electronic Brake force Distribution (EBD) splash guards, Diversity Antenna and available factory-activated XM ® Satellite Radio (required monthly subscription sold separately).

The fourth-generation Altima utilizes the Nissan 'D' platform with improved body rigidity and a redesigned, sporty suspension. This new platform was developed as the foundation that makes Altima one of the best performing large front-wheel drive sedans available globally. The new Altima is available with Nissan's advanced Xtronic CVT™ (Continuously Variable Transmission) or 6-speed manual transmissions and a choice of the award-winning VQ-series 3.5-liter V6 or powerful 2.5-liter 4-cylinder engines

Advanced Platform, Engaging Performance

2008 Nissan Altima
Altima's exhilarating driving pleasure comes from a tuned combination of strong acceleration, responsive handling and dynamic sound – provided by the rigid 'D' platform and advanced engine designs.

The 2008 Altima continues to utilize Nissan's innovative 'D' platform, which offers improved body rigidity over the previous design, and an advanced independent front suspension with dynamic geometry and shock absorbers with rebound springs.

A low engine-mounting position features a six-point pendulum-type mounting system and the half-shafts are set at equal angles and nearly parallel to the ground – virtually eliminating torque steer.

Altima's subframe-mounted front suspension makes extensive use of lightweight aluminum parts. An X-type upper cowl structure helps establish front body rigidity for suspension mounting. The rear multi-link independent suspension design separates the rear shock absorbers and springs for minimized friction and the shocks are in line with the center of the rear wheels, providing excellent damping and almost no harshness. Front and rear stabilizer bars are standard.

Altima 3.5 SE offers larger diameter stabilizer bars and unique spring rates and strut damping, as well as 17-inch wheels and tires.

Two powerplants are available in the 2008 Altima, the 13-time Ward's '10 Best Engines' award-winning VQ-series V6 and an inline 4-cylinder.

The 3.5-liter 24-valve DOHC V6 is rated at 270 horsepower and 258 lb-ft of torque and offers strong acceleration and a tuned, resonant sound quality. The V6 features minimized friction, superior cylinder head cooling and twin knock sensors.

Also available is a 2.5-liter DOHC 16-valve 4-cylinder producing 175 horsepower (170 hp CAL) and 180 lb-ft of torque (175 lb-ft CAL). The QR25 engine was refined for 2007 with a larger intake manifold, increased compression ratio (9.6:1 from 9.5:1) and reduced friction characteristics. It features a silent chain drive and a balancer system (with balancer changed to a center-mounted location for excellent NVH) that effectively negates vibrations without taking up much space – combining ideal packaging and smoothness.

Both engines feature continuously variable valve timing, modular engine design, microfinished crank journals and cam lobes, molybdenum coated lightweight pistons and electronically controlled throttles.

Altima's standard dual exhaust system is designed to reduce exhaust backpressure by 35% on the 4-cylinder and 50% with the V6 (over the previous generations). Both systems utilize large tube diameters and include dual chrome-tipped exhaust finishers.

Smooth, Efficient Xtronic CVT

The 2008 Altima is offered with a choice of two transmissions with both the V6 and 4-cylinder engines. A 6-speed, narrow-gate manual features low friction, short shift stroke, high torque capacity and close gear ratios covering a wide range. The Xtronic CVT is designed to create a true synergy between engine and transmission with smooth, responsive, fluid-feeling performance and efficient operation. The CVT units utilized with both engines have been tailored specifically for use with the Altima.

The V6 CVT features a 'Sport' mode controller with a high-speed central processing unit and Adaptive Shift Controller with adaptive logic for fast shifting in both normal and manual modes. The adaptive logic feature delivers the best shift pattern based on the driving environment and driver's perceived intentions. It utilizes 700 programmed algorithms to adjust to differing conditions, such as uphill or downhill driving, as well as adapting to three styles of driving – economy, normal and sporty.

Vehicle Dynamic Control (VDC) with Traction Control System (TCS) is available as an option with Altima 3.5-lter V6 equipped models.

Superior Structure, Steering and Braking

The 2008 Altima's sturdy body structure includes extensive use of Últra High Strength Steel, which is utilized in many locations around the vehicle, including side-impact areas.
Altima's standard twin-orifice vehicle-speed-sensitive power rack-and-pinion steering system provides light steering effort at low speeds and a secure feeling at high speeds, along with a secure, 'on center' feel.

Braking for the 2008 Altima is provided by standard 4-wheel disc brakes with 4-wheel, 4-channel, 4-sensor Anti-lock Braking System (ABS) with Electronic Brake force Distribution (EBD), which optimizes brake force depending on load condition (passengers and cargo). A variable ratio pivot brake pedal provides a rigid feel at freeway speeds and less sensitive, more controllable operation in city driving.

Altima models equipped with the 4-cylinder engine are equipped with 16-inch wheels (steel wheels with covers on 2.5 and 2.5 S, aluminum-alloy wheels are optional on 2.5 S and standard on 2.5 S with SL Package) and 215/60R16 tires. The V6-equipped Altima 3.5 SL comes standard with 16-inch aluminum-alloy wheels, while the Altima 3.5 SE features 17-inch aluminum-alloy wheels and 215/55R17 tires.

Next-Generation Nissan Altima Coupe Brings Style, Emotion and Sophistication to Mid-Size Coupe Market

– New Altima Coupe Debuts at Los Angeles Auto Show; Offers Úpscale Styling, Sporty Performance, Driver-Oriented Interior and High Quality –

The Nissan Altima is a car on the move. With its next generation design for the 2007 model year, Nissan's best-selling vehicle in the Únited States is poised for even greater success as it establishes segment leadership in style, design, performance and innovation. The next-generation Altima is also expanding its model offerings with a new Altima Hybrid, set to go on sale in select markets in January 2007, and a dramatically styled new Altima Coupe, which will go on sale as a 2008 model in summer 2007.

The Altima Coupe, which made its debut in the shadows of Hollywood at the 2006 Los Angeles Auto Show, fills a desire among target customers for a more personal expression of style, individuality and fashionable appearance. The Altima Coupe's unique exterior design is intended to stand out in a crowd of sedan-based two-door models with magnetic, perfectly proportioned styling with a shorter wheelbase, shorter overall length and lower height than the Altima Sedan.


2008 Nissan AltimaThe smaller size and lighter overall weight also contribute to the Coupe's sportier driving feel – other desired attributes of the typically younger, more performance-oriented coupe buyers.

'Rather than just eliminating two doors from the Altima Sedan, we gave the Altima Coupe its own style, its own dimensions and its own interpretation of Nissan's exhilarating driving pleasure,' said Bill Bosley, vice president and general manager, Nissan Division.

Though the new Altima Coupe shares much with the latest edition of the Altima Sedan, which went on sale in early November 2006, the Coupe's smaller dimensions, driver-oriented cockpit and unique styling give it an extensive amount of separation from the Altima Sedan.


Dimensionally, the Altima Coupe rides on a 105.3-inch wheelbase, a full 4.0 inches shorter than the Sedan. Overall length is 182.5 inches – 7.1 inches less than the Sedan. The Coupe also has a lower profile – at 55.3 inches it is 2.5 inches shorter than the Sedan. In terms of major body panels, the two cars share only a common hood, with all other panels, grille, headlights and rear combination lights unique to the Altima Coupe.

Únder the new Altima Coupe's sophisticated exterior design, this latest addition to the Altima family shares the platform, powertrain and user-friendly features and innovations of the new fourth-generation Altima.

The Altima Coupe, as part of the fourth-generation Altima design, utilizes Nissan's all-new, highly acclaimed 'D' platform with increased body rigidity and a redesigned suspension. This new platform was developed with the objective of making Altima one of the best performing large front-wheel drive vehicles available globally.

2008 Nissan AltimaNew suspension geometry, shock absorbers with rebound springs, engine placement that is lower in the subframe and equal-length half-shafts that have equal angles and are more parallel to the ground all help to virtually eliminate torque steer.

The rear multi-link independent suspension design separates the rear shocks and springs for reduced friction and the shocks are in line with the center of the rear wheels, providing better damping and less harshness. Front and rear stabilizer bars are standard. The Altima suspension has been specially tuned for use with the Altima Coupe.

The new Altima Coupe is offered with a choice of two engines and two transmissions. The 3.5-liter 24-valve DOHC V6 is the 'next generation' version of the 12-time Ward's '10 Best Engines' award-winning VQ-series V6. For use in the Altima Coupe, it is rated at 270 horsepower and 258 lb-ft of torque and offers strong acceleration and refined sound quality. The V6 features reduced friction, improved cylinder head cooling and new twin knock sensors.

Also available with the new Altima Coupe is a 2.5-liter DOHC 16-valve QR25 inline 4-cylinder, producing 175 horsepower (170 hp CAL) and 180 lb-ft of torque (175 lb-ft CAL). This engine has been refined from the previous version, with a larger, equal-length intake manifold, increased compression ratio and reduced friction characteristics. It features a silent chain drive and a balancer system (with balancer changed to a center-mounted location for better NVH) that effectively negates vibrations without taking up much space – combining ideal packaging and smoothness.

Both engines feature continuously variable valve timing, modular engine design, microfinished crank journals and cam lobes, molybdenum coated lightweight pistons and electronically controlled throttles.

2008 Nissan AltimaBoth the 3.5-liter V6 and 2.5-liter 4-cylinder models are available with Nissan's advanced Xtronic CVT™ (Continuously Variable Transmission) or 6-speed manual transmissions.

The V6 CVT features a 'Sport' mode controller with a high-speed central processing unit and Adaptive Shift Controller with adaptive logic for faster shifting in both normal and manual modes. The adaptive logic feature delivers the best shift pattern based on the driving environment and driver's perceived intentions.
